Objectives
Streamline school transportation patterns
Maximize pedestrian traffic in draw pool
Create efficiency in parental drop-offs
Encourage alternative forms of transportation
Neighborhood rejuvenation/beautification
Transportation Patterns
Current number of buses
Routes and stops of buses
Dot density map of school-aged children
Age-to-transportation mode chart
Pedestrian Traffic
Sidewalk condition analysis
Safe havens
Neighborhood watch programs
“Walking School Bus”
Overcoming traffic hazards and physical barriers
Implement additional crossing guards
Parental Drop-offs
Assess current parking lot functionality
Time analysis of drop-off cycle
Identify most efficient entry and egress points
Pinpoint issues/problems with current regimen
Alternative Transportation
Establish bike and walking lanes
Assign bike routes
Install bike racks/skate storage
Feasibility of Safe Routes to School Program
GPS checkpoints
Neighborhood Rejuvenation
Improve safety measures
Reassign underutilized street lanes
Beautify streetscapes and signage
Plant additional foliage
Repurpose empty lots
Create a sense of community
